The Secret Life of Fireplace Ash: Why You Should Never Discard It

Fireplace ash, often perceived as a benign byproduct of a cozy fire, harbors a deceptive danger. Despite appearing cool and harmless, it can retain enough heat to ignite combustible materials, posing a significant fire risk. This often-underestimated hazard means that proper storage and disposal of fireplace ash are not just recommendations, but crucial safety measures for every homeowner who enjoys the warmth of a hearth or wood stove.

“Ash is seemingly harmless and cold before it actually is,” warns Lo Choe, a Licensed Fire Safety Contractor and Owner of Aura Fire Safety. This critical insight underscores the importance of diligent ash management. For those who regularly use a fireplace or wood stove, dealing with ash is a constant chore. A single cord of wood can generate enough ash to fill a 5-gallon bucket, making safe handling a continuous priority. This comprehensive guide, with expert advice from Lo Choe, will walk you through the essential steps for safely storing fireplace ash and highlight common mistakes to avoid, ensuring your home remains secure.

Unlocking the Potential: Practical Household Uses for Fireplace Ash

Beyond its reputation as a potential fire hazard, fireplace ash boasts an array of surprising and practical applications around the home and garden. Far from being mere waste, properly handled wood ash can become a valuable resource. These uses not only offer sustainable solutions but also demonstrate the versatility of this seemingly simple byproduct.

1. Natural Silver Polish

Tired of tarnished silver? Fireplace ash offers an eco-friendly and effective solution. Create a thick, abrasive paste by mixing finely sifted ash with a small amount of water. Apply this paste gently to tarnished silver items using a soft cloth, moving in a circular motion. The fine abrasive particles in the ash, combined with its alkaline properties, work to remove tarnish and restore shine. Always wear gloves during application to protect your hands, and buff with a clean, dry cloth once finished for a brilliant, streak-free gleam. This method is particularly effective for antique silver or pieces that might be too delicate for harsh chemical cleaners.

2. Odor Absorber and Deodorizer

The porous nature of wood ash makes it an excellent natural deodorizer. In outhouses or composting toilets, a sprinkle of ash after each use can effectively neutralize odors and help break down organic matter. For musty rooms or areas with persistent unpleasant smells, such as near a litter box, simply place an open bowl of ashes. The ash will absorb airborne odors, leaving the space smelling fresher without the need for artificial air fresheners. Its ability to absorb moisture also contributes to its deodorizing power, tackling the root cause of many unpleasant smells.

3. Garden Helper and Pest Deterrent

Untreated wood ash is a gardener’s secret weapon, rich in essential minerals like potassium, calcium, and magnesium. These nutrients are particularly beneficial for “potash-loving” plants such as tomatoes, fruit trees, and many vegetables, promoting stronger growth and better yields. Sprinkle a thin layer of ash around the base of these plants, ensuring it doesn’t form a thick crust. Additionally, ash acts as a natural pest deterrent. Slugs and other crawling insects are averse to crossing a barrier of ash, as its abrasive and dehydrating properties disrupt their movement. Create a protective ring around vulnerable plants to keep these unwelcome guests at bay. It’s crucial to use only ash from untreated wood, as ash from treated lumber can introduce harmful chemicals into your soil.

4. Compost Pile Ingredient

Incorporating wood ash into your compost pile can significantly enhance its quality. Ash serves as an excellent pH balancer, helping to neutralize acidic compost and create a more hospitable environment for beneficial microorganisms. Beyond pH adjustment, it enriches the compost with vital minerals such as potassium, calcium, and magnesium, which are then released into the soil when the compost is used. Add ash in moderation, mixing it thoroughly into the pile, to avoid excessively raising the pH, which could harm some beneficial microbes. This sustainable practice turns waste into a valuable soil amendment.

5. Traditional Natural Soap Making

For the adventurous and historically-minded, fireplace ash can be used to create lye, a fundamental ingredient in traditional soap making. The process involves slowly dripping water through a large quantity of ash, collecting the resulting caustic liquid, known as lye extract. This lye is then carefully cooked with rendered animal fat or vegetable oils through a process called saponification, which transforms the fats and lye into liquid soap. This intricate, multi-day process requires caution due to the highly caustic nature of lye, as detailed in resources like this guide on making lye. While a fascinating historical application, modern soap makers often opt for commercially produced lye for safety and consistency.

6. Gravel Driveway Maintenance

Maintaining a gravel driveway can be a continuous task, but fireplace ash offers a surprising solution for weed control and pothole repair. Spreading thin layers of ash across gravel driveways can help suppress weed growth, as the ash creates a less hospitable environment for seeds to germinate. More remarkably, when wet, ash mixes with gravel and dries to a harder, more compact consistency. This property makes it an effective material for filling small potholes and improving the overall stability of the driveway. Its binding qualities help to lock the gravel in place, reducing washout and extending the life of your driveway with a natural, readily available resource.

7. Soil pH Neutralizer

Many garden and lawn soils naturally lean towards acidity, which can inhibit the growth of certain plants. Wood ash is an alkaline substance, making it an excellent natural liming agent to raise the pH of acidic soil. By mixing ash with garden soil or spreading it thinly over your lawn, you can create a more balanced environment, beneficial for plants that thrive in neutral to slightly alkaline conditions. Before applying large quantities, it’s wise to conduct a soil test to determine your current pH levels and avoid over-alkalizing the soil, which can be just as detrimental as overly acidic conditions. Always apply ash sparingly and evenly.

8. De-icer and Traction Aid

During icy winter months, fireplace ash can be a simple yet effective tool for improving safety on walkways and driveways. Spreading ash over icy surfaces significantly increases traction, reducing the risk of slips and falls. The dark color of the ash also absorbs sunlight, which can help increase melting speeds and further mitigate ice hazards. Unlike rock salt, ash won’t harm plants or pets, making it a more environmentally friendly alternative. Keep a bucket of ash near your entrances for quick and easy application when winter weather strikes, providing a safer path for everyone.

9. Glass Cleaner

The fine abrasive qualities of fireplace ash make it surprisingly effective for cleaning glass, particularly the stubborn soot and creosote buildup on wood stove glass doors. Dip a damp paper towel or soft cloth into fine, cooled ash and gently scrub the glass. The mild abrasiveness of the ash, without the harsh chemicals found in commercial cleaners, effectively cuts through grime. Finish by wiping with a clean, damp cloth and then drying with a lint-free cloth or newspaper for a sparkling, clear view of your fire. This method is not only effective but also uses a readily available resource, reducing your reliance on chemical cleaning products.

Beyond the Blaze: Why Proper Ash Storage Matters for Safety and Health

The diligent storage of fireplace ash extends far beyond merely preventing a fire. It encompasses crucial considerations for both immediate safety and long-term health. While the primary concern is undoubtedly the risk of combustion, ash also poses significant risks to respiratory health and can cause skin irritation if mishandled. Understanding these multifaceted dangers underscores why proper ash management is a non-negotiable aspect of home safety.

From a health perspective, fireplace ash, though not inherently toxic in small, incidental exposures, contains crystalline silica. When ash is disturbed, especially during sweeping or transfer, these microscopic particles can become airborne. Inhaling crystalline silica over time can lead to serious respiratory issues, including silicosis, a debilitating lung disease. Therefore, minimizing dust exposure by handling ash carefully and wearing appropriate personal protective equipment, such as a dust mask, is paramount. Furthermore, when mixed with liquid, such as water or even sweat, ash becomes highly caustic due to the formation of lye. This caustic mixture can cause chemical burns to exposed skin, ranging from mild irritation to more severe damage. Always wear gloves and long sleeves when handling ash to protect your skin from this corrosive reaction.

By addressing these fire and health risks through proper storage techniques, homeowners not only safeguard their property but also protect themselves and their families from avoidable hazards. This holistic approach to ash management ensures that the comforting warmth of a fireplace doesn’t come at the cost of safety or well-being.

Can Storing Ash Be a Fire Risk? The Hidden Dangers Explained

The seemingly inert nature of fireplace ash can be dangerously deceptive. Many homeowners assume that once the flames are gone and the visible embers have died down, the ash is completely safe. However, this assumption is a common cause of residential fires. The truth is, if stored improperly, fireplace ash can indeed pose a very real and significant fire risk. Here’s a deeper look into why this is the case:

Hidden, Smoldering Embers

The most critical and often overlooked danger lies within the ash itself: hidden embers. Even when the ash appears completely cool and lifeless on the surface, pockets of smoldering embers can persist deep within. “The ash may appear lifeless, but it’s merely insulated and yearning for oxygen,” Lo Choe emphasizes. These embers, deprived of oxygen, can smolder for hours, sometimes even days, at extremely high temperatures. If these dormant embers are suddenly exposed to a fresh supply of oxygen – perhaps by being disturbed, or if the container is not airtight – they can quickly reignite, potentially turning into a full-blown flame capable of igniting nearby combustible materials.

The Insulating Power of Ash

Ash itself is an excellent insulator. This property, while beneficial for retaining heat in a firebox, becomes a hazard during storage. A layer of seemingly cool ash acts like a blanket, effectively insulating any remaining hot embers deep within the pile. This insulation prevents heat from dissipating quickly, keeping the embers hot for an extended period, even several days after the visible fire has ceased. Lo Choe recounts, “In some cases, I’ve seen ember-size pieces of coal remain over 400 degrees Fahrenheit while nestled in gray ash several inches deep.” This extraordinary heat retention means that even a small amount of ash can harbor enough residual heat to ignite flammable substances if not handled with extreme caution.

Extended Cooling Time Requirements

Given the insulating properties and the presence of hidden embers, ash requires a substantial amount of time to cool completely and no longer pose a fire risk. It’s not a matter of hours, but often days. “Fireplace ash has the potential to hold live embers between 24 to 72 hours depending on variables,” Choe explains. These variables include the type of wood burned, the volume of ash, and ambient temperatures. A large volume of dense hardwood ash in a cool environment will retain heat much longer than a small amount of softwood ash in a warm, open space. Rushing the cooling process and disposing of ash prematurely is a recipe for disaster, as those lingering embers can easily ignite trash bins or other flammable materials.

Perils of Improper Storage Choices

The choice of container and storage location is paramount. Ash stored in any flammable container – such as a cardboard box, a plastic bin, or even a heavy-duty trash bag – creates an immediate and severe fire hazard. Similarly, placing even a “cooled” container of ash on combustible surfaces like wooden decks, carpet, or near curtains, firewood, or other flammable items, invites catastrophe. The radiant heat from smoldering embers can penetrate seemingly safe containers or surfaces, igniting surrounding materials. Understanding these risks is the first step toward implementing safe ash storage practices and protecting your home from preventable fires.

Mastering Ash Management: How to Store Fireplace Ash Safely and Responsibly

Safely storing fireplace ash is a critical aspect of home fire prevention that every fireplace and wood stove user must master. It’s a straightforward process, but one that demands unwavering attention to detail and adherence to specific guidelines. By following these expert recommendations, you can mitigate the significant risks associated with ash and ensure your home remains safe.

The Uncompromising Rule of the Metal Container

The cornerstone of safe ash storage is the container itself. You must always store fireplace ash in a heavy-duty metal container with a tight-fitting lid. This is not merely a suggestion but a mandatory safety requirement. Lo Choe emphatically states, “No plastic bags or sheet liners.” Plastic will melt and ignite, while even seemingly robust paper bags offer no protection against extreme heat. The metal bucket acts as a non-combustible barrier, containing any lingering heat or re-ignited embers. A tight-fitting lid is equally crucial, as it starves any potential embers of oxygen, preventing them from flaring up and containing any sparks that might escape.

Strategic Placement: Location, Location, Location

Once ash is placed into its designated metal container, the next critical step is where you place it. The container must be kept on a non-combustible surface. Think concrete, brick, stone, or bare dirt – surfaces that cannot catch fire. Crucially, this safe spot must be a minimum of 10 feet away from any flammable materials. This includes your house, wooden decks, fences, piles of firewood, dry leaves, curtains, or anything else that could potentially ignite. This buffer zone is vital for protecting your property should any embers manage to escape or cause the container itself to heat up significantly. An isolated concrete patio or a clear patch of gravel in your yard makes an ideal location.

The Patience of Cooling: Time is Your Ally

Despite appearances, ash needs considerable time to cool completely. Never assume ash is safe just because it feels cool to the touch after a few hours. “Allow it to cool for a full 72 hours before placing it in the trash, even if it feels cool after 12 hours,” advises Choe. This extended cooling period accounts for the insulating properties of ash, which can keep embers smoldering deep within the pile for days. Rushing this step is a primary cause of fires in outdoor trash bins or during municipal waste collection. For an added layer of safety, especially if you need to expedite the cooling or are particularly concerned, you can spray the ash down with water inside the metal container before securing the lid. This helps to fully extinguish any lingering embers and reduces dust, but remember that even wetted ash still requires time to ensure all heat has dissipated.

Ash Removal Best Practices

When it’s time to remove ash from your fireplace or wood stove, do so carefully. Use a metal shovel to scoop the ash into your designated metal container. Avoid overfilling the container, as this can make it unstable and difficult to secure the lid. Always wear heavy-duty gloves and a dust mask to protect your hands from potential burns and your lungs from inhaling fine ash particles. Try to disturb the ash as little as possible to minimize airborne dust. Once transferred, immediately close the lid and move the container to its designated safe, outdoor location for the recommended cooling period.

Non-Negotiables: What NOT to Do When Handling and Storing Fireplace Ash

While understanding proper ash storage is vital, it’s equally important to be aware of practices that absolutely must be avoided. These “don’ts” are common mistakes that can lead to devastating fires or health hazards. Adhering to these warnings is as crucial as following the safe storage guidelines.

  • Never store ash in an open container. An open container not only fails to prevent smoldering embers from reigniting but also allows sparks to escape. If accidentally knocked over, hot ash can spill onto flammable surfaces, instantly causing a fire. Always use a metal container with a secure, tight-fitting lid.
  • “Never vacuum fireplace ash from your fireplace into a household vacuum,” warns Lo Choe. This is a critical safety rule. Fine ash particles can easily bypass a household vacuum’s filters, reaching the motor. Even seemingly cold ash can contain latent heat, and once these hot particles come into contact with the vacuum’s motor, they can ignite accumulated dust and debris, causing a fire within the vacuum cleaner itself. Use a specialized ash vacuum or a shovel and metal bucket.
  • Never dispose of ash in a trash bag with other household trash before it has completely cooled. Even if you place it in a separate bag within the main trash, hot ash can melt through plastic, ignite paper, or cause a fire in the trash can, collection truck, or landfill. Always wait the full 72 hours and place cooled ash in its own bag, clearly marked, or mix it with inert materials if allowed by your local waste management.
  • “Never leave your ashes in a pile on your wooden front porch or next to dry leaves in your yard,” Choe stresses. This creates an immediate and extreme fire hazard. Wooden structures, dry vegetation, and other combustible materials can easily ignite from residual heat or re-igniting embers. Always move ash to a safe, non-combustible outdoor location, observing the 10-foot rule.
  • Never dispose of ash on a windy day. A strong gust of wind can provide the oxygen needed to revive smoldering embers, causing them to flare up and potentially scatter hot ash over a wide area. This poses a risk of brush fires or igniting nearby structures. If you must dispose of ash on a windy day, ensure it is thoroughly doused with water and use extreme caution.
  • Never store ash near flammable items. This includes newspapers, magazines, curtains, rugs, carpeting, firewood, gasoline, or any other combustible materials. The radiant heat from even a safely contained bucket of ash can be enough to ignite nearby flammables over time. Maintain a strict clearance zone around your ash storage container.
